Where and how people live — the homes, how they are held, and what they cost.
Far more people live in separate houses in Holmesville than across New South Wales, with 99.4% of dwellings being detached. This is a place of large family homes, where the typical household owns their property and most homes have at least three bedrooms.

Rents, mortgages and crowding.
Typical weekly rents are $390, which is much higher than most similar areas. Meanwhile, the typical monthly mortgage payment is $1,733, a figure that is well below the New South Wales average.

How homes are owned or rented.
Home ownership is strong here, with 37.3% of homes owned outright, which is well above the national figure. Only 14.1% of households rent, a proportion far below both the state and national averages.

Houses, townhouses, apartments and bedrooms.
The area is dominated by large homes, as 87.1% have three or more bedrooms, far above the New South Wales figure of 68.6%. This is reflected in the high density of residents, with 0.90 people per bedroom, which is much higher than most areas.
